Output 3137275d95c3502c3e6e64a9cc88a697cc1cb4c6c03f3e619a28b909c43112fc:0

value
19984000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5727a6e882f4590df4575329a99ed4e23e28bc OP_EQUAL
address
3EfeHQpz4m6bVCenHkBCsGGE8ZfZXBwH9R
transaction
3137275d95c3502c3e6e64a9cc88a697cc1cb4c6c03f3e619a28b909c43112fc
spent
true